Naguit, Arceo set records in Sto. Tomas politics

STO. TOMAS – Mayor Joselito Naguit and running mate Mark Louie Arceo had set a record in the town’s politics as the first ever three termed mayor and youngest vice mayor in the province respectively.

This came Commission on Elections yesterday formally proclaimed Naguit as legally elected mayor and Arceo as vice mayor  in a simple ceremony led by the Municipal Election Officer Imelda Manalastas.

“Siyempre masaya ako dahil ako ang kauna unahang 3 termed mayor sa bayan ng Sto. Tomas at nakita naman ng ating mga kababayan ang maganda nating ginawa para sa kanilang kapakanan,” he said.

Naguit obtained some 12,880 votes while his political rival Romeo Ronquillo garnered 6,274 only.

His running mate Arceo vested the incumbent Vice Mayor Gloria Ronquillo with 11,396 votes compared to 6,841 of the latter.

The mayor added with the overwhelming support manifested by the people in Sto. Tomas in the recently concluded elections, he would further intensify the delivery of basic services to the communities.

“Maaalis na niyan ang impression sa mga tao na pera pera lang ang laban. Magagawa na natin ang mga proyektong tutulong sa pag unlad ng ating bayan,” he stated.
Naguit told Sun Star Pampanga in an interview that he is also happy with the election of Arceo as vice mayor as their good relationship will speed up implementation of program for the general welfare of the people.

“Masaya ako dahil nanalo ang aking vice mayor. Kung kasangga natin siya ay lalung gaganda ang plano natin sa Sto. Tomas,” he said.
